Summary

Meta Platforms, Inc. has filed a WARN notice indicating plans to lay off 1,395 employees in Washington, with the layoffs set to begin in July 2023. This decision reflects ongoing adjustments within the company as it navigates current market conditions. The WARN notice serves as a formal notification to the state and affected employees about the upcoming job cuts. The layoffs are part of a broader trend in the tech industry, where companies are reevaluating their workforce in response to economic pressures.

Meta Platforms, Inc. cut 1,395 jobs.

That is roughly 1.9% of the 72,404 people Meta Platforms, Inc. employs.
